Pre-Enrollment Checklist: What to Confirm Before You Book
Use these checkpoints to evaluate. First, confirm the session format: group or private, session length, and whether partners or support persons are welcome. Next, check the curriculum balance—education on labor and birth stages, comfort measures, and postpartum basics. Ask how the instructor handles different birth scenarios and whether they teach evidence-based options in an open, respectful way. Make sure the class Pregnancy & Birth Care Doula includes hands-on practice such as breathing, positioning, relaxation, and coping strategies. Finally, verify communication style: opportunities for Q&A, non-judgmental discussion, and individualized guidance that acknowledges your medical context. In-Class Checklist: Skills You Should Walk Away With
Once you attend, check that the learning is practical. You should leave with a clear understanding of what happens during labor, including common sensations and how to respond. Your toolkit should include breathing techniques, effective relaxation cues, and comfort strategies like movement, massage basics, and focused coping. Look for teaching that helps you communicate with your care team—how to ask questions, how to express preferences, and how to stay grounded when plans change. A strong class also supports emotional readiness: managing fear, reducing overwhelm, and building a sense of agency. If the approach includes partner coaching, confirm that support persons learn how to help with pacing, reassurance, and advocacy.
